Airo B. Tacujan
A Personal Profile Blog of a Technical Generalist Who Enjoys Building DIY Systems.
Projects
1. Project Sparta — Lightweight Database & Content Management System
A system initiated by local government teachers to manage athlete records and local sports news on extremely low-cost hardware.
It serves as a central database for student-athletes, with restricted access for coaches, teachers, and students. Stats are transformed into shareable digital profiles, alongside a built-in community news magazine.
The concept was driven by the teachers and coaches, so I designed the system around their number one requirement: to keep it running no matter what.
Less focus on visuals, more on uptime and efficiency.
Key Highlights:
- Athlete Record Management: Structured database for storing and organizing student-athlete data and performance statistics
- Simple Dashboard: For athletes, teachers, coaches, and journalists
- Low-Resource Deployment: Built without heavy frameworks to run efficiently on low-cost hardware
- Multi-User Workflows: Supports concurrent updates from multiple contributors
- Stability & Security: Designed for high uptime and data protection under constrained resources
System Architecture:
- Backend: Object-Oriented PHP with optimized MariaDB queries
- Infrastructure: Debian 13 / Nginx on Amazon Cloud Free Tier
- Security: Reverse proxy + AWS Security Group + backend validation layers
- Frontend: Modern Native JS (ES6+), CSS3, HTML5
Live: www.projectsparta.net
2. Dark SciFi — Private Publishing System (Active Development)
A framework-less publishing platform I’m actively building and experimenting on.
It’s designed for controlled multi-author collaboration with invite-only access and a custom karma system. Right now, I’m the main writer, but the system is being built to scale beyond just me.
It also doubles as my testing ground for automation, crawling, and scraping.
Key Highlights:
- Invitation-only access control system
- Custom karma/reputation mechanics
- Designed for future multi-author scalability
System Architecture:
- Backend: Object-Oriented PHP with MariaDB
- Infrastructure: Debian 12 / Nginx on VPS
- Security: Reverse proxy, firewall layer, backend validation, and Telegram API alerting mechanism
- Frontend: Modern Native JS, CSS3, HTML5
Live: www.darkscifi.com
3. Ethical Automated Data Gathering and Lead Aggregator (Ongoing Testing)
I build across programming, databases, server administration, cloud infrastructure, and third-party API integrations through systems that collect and organize data responsibly. I design around ethical data collection and automation workflows within platform rules and robots.txt constraints.
Current Stack:
I prefer building systems with minimal dependency on large platforms or managed services. Control, efficiency, and independence are key factors in how I design and deploy my solutions.
Node.js environment using Axios and Playwright for data acquisition, Cheerio for parsing, Apify for scalable automation workflows, and MariaDB for structured data storage.
GitHub links for my projects coming soon.
Self Thought Skills
1. Writing
By leveraging available AI tools, I turn my thoughts into clearer and more structured writing.
Technical Writing (Samples Only)
- Infrastructure Strategy: ProjectSparta.net migration (Shared Hosting → AWS Free Tier)
- Refactoring vs Rewrite Proposal (Visayan Global Insurance Group)
Creative Writing
- Lead Contributor at DarkSciFi.com (short stories and articles)
2. Repair Skills
- MTB maintenance and repair (self-taught, including roadside repairs during long rides)
- Low-displacement motorcycle maintenance and repair (self-taught through trial, error, and repetition)
- Electrical wiring repair and fixes (self-taught, practical experience)
Contact
- Telegram: https://t.me/tacujanab (my scripts and bots contact me in this channel 24/7)